<feed xmlns='http://www.w3.org/2005/Atom'>
<title>vyos-1x.git/data/config-mode-dependencies, branch circinus-merge-commit-handling</title>
<subtitle>VyOS command definitions, scripts, and utilities (mirror of https://github.com/vyos/vyos-1x.git)
</subtitle>
<id>https://git.amelek.net/vyos/vyos-1x.git/atom?h=circinus-merge-commit-handling</id>
<link rel='self' href='https://git.amelek.net/vyos/vyos-1x.git/atom?h=circinus-merge-commit-handling'/>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/'/>
<updated>2024-07-25T16:07:28+00:00</updated>
<entry>
<title>system_option: T5552: Apply IPv4 and IPv6 options after reapplying sysctls by TuneD (#3863)</title>
<updated>2024-07-25T16:07:28+00:00</updated>
<author>
<name>mergify[bot]</name>
<email>37929162+mergify[bot]@users.noreply.github.com</email>
</author>
<published>2024-07-25T16:07:28+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=609f4b9c1bb7f3144a997f76e74e86bef0559b23'/>
<id>urn:sha1:609f4b9c1bb7f3144a997f76e74e86bef0559b23</id>
<content type='text'>
(cherry picked from commit 7b82e4005724683c6311fab22358746f2cca4c1b)

Co-authored-by: Nataliia Solomko &lt;natalirs1985@gmail.com&gt;</content>
</entry>
<entry>
<title>Merge pull request #3612 from c-po/haproxy-pki-T6463</title>
<updated>2024-06-10T08:27:14+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2024-06-10T08:27: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=7ade4fa71b535289577978a73746c1fc1d993803'/>
<id>urn:sha1:7ade4fa71b535289577978a73746c1fc1d993803</id>
<content type='text'>
pki: T6463: reverse-proxy service not reloaded when updating SSL certificate(s)</content>
</entry>
<entry>
<title>pki: T6464: sstpc interface not reloaded when updating SSL certificate(s)</title>
<updated>2024-06-09T18:52:15+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2024-06-09T18:52: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=42294ccd904773fa19a6af0f37cf9526321d87e4'/>
<id>urn:sha1:42294ccd904773fa19a6af0f37cf9526321d87e4</id>
<content type='text'>
The SSTPC client was not reloaded/restarted with the new SSL certificate(s)
after a change in the PKI subsystem.

This was due to missing dependencies.
</content>
</entry>
<entry>
<title>pki: T6463: reverse-proxy service not reloaded when updating SSL certificate(s)</title>
<updated>2024-06-09T18:45:04+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2024-06-09T18:45:04+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=6ce8efdc8dafef67541bed89fc7dc7cd83335bf4'/>
<id>urn:sha1:6ce8efdc8dafef67541bed89fc7dc7cd83335bf4</id>
<content type='text'>
The haproxy reverse proxy was not reloaded/restarted with the new SSL
certificate(s) after a change in the PKI subsystem. This was due to missing
dependencies.
</content>
</entry>
<entry>
<title>bridge: T6317: add dependency call for wireless interfaces</title>
<updated>2024-05-08T19:47:40+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2024-05-08T19:40:35+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=431443ab3f663a6617008536d2d6d96407aebfcb'/>
<id>urn:sha1:431443ab3f663a6617008536d2d6d96407aebfcb</id>
<content type='text'>
</content>
</entry>
<entry>
<title>T6084: Add NHRP dependency for IPsec and fix NHRP empty config bug</title>
<updated>2024-03-04T10:23:26+00:00</updated>
<author>
<name>Viacheslav Hletenko</name>
<email>v.gletenko@vyos.io</email>
</author>
<published>2024-03-04T10:23:26+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=689fea253d9019df20d5c6ac7fa22d5e8454afab'/>
<id>urn:sha1:689fea253d9019df20d5c6ac7fa22d5e8454afab</id>
<content type='text'>
If we have any `vpn ipsec` and `protocol nhrp` configuration we
get the empty configuration file `/run/opennhrp/opennhrp.conf`
after rebooting the system.

Use config dependency instead of the old `resync_nhrp` function
fixes this issue
</content>
</entry>
<entry>
<title>vrf: conntrack: T6073: Populate VRF zoning chains only while conntrack is required</title>
<updated>2024-02-27T21:35:11+00:00</updated>
<author>
<name>sarthurdev</name>
<email>965089+sarthurdev@users.noreply.github.com</email>
</author>
<published>2024-02-27T20:38: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=6f7d1e15665655e37e8ca830e28d9650445c1217'/>
<id>urn:sha1:6f7d1e15665655e37e8ca830e28d9650445c1217</id>
<content type='text'>
</content>
</entry>
<entry>
<title>pki: T6034: add dependencies to trigger rpki re-run on openssh key update</title>
<updated>2024-02-12T20:16:12+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2024-02-12T20:16:12+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=0f8bf6bd0fb29cfd638e9920674e7ad1d1d25350'/>
<id>urn:sha1:0f8bf6bd0fb29cfd638e9920674e7ad1d1d25350</id>
<content type='text'>
</content>
</entry>
<entry>
<title>vpn: T3843: l2tp configuration not cleared after delete</title>
<updated>2024-02-06T10:36:38+00:00</updated>
<author>
<name>khramshinr</name>
<email>khramshinr@gmail.com</email>
</author>
<published>2024-02-06T10:35:27+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=e697ed1e7fd5c33f8082b2f4f96c42fc822ec9a5'/>
<id>urn:sha1:e697ed1e7fd5c33f8082b2f4f96c42fc822ec9a5</id>
<content type='text'>
vpn: T5926: IPSEC does not apply after l2tp configuration was changed

added dependency between l2tp and ipsec conf
added test for apply config to swanctl
</content>
</entry>
<entry>
<title>T5474: establish common file name pattern for XML conf mode commands</title>
<updated>2023-12-31T22:49:48+00:00</updated>
<author>
<name>Christian Breunig</name>
<email>christian@breunig.cc</email>
</author>
<published>2023-12-30T22:25: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/vyos/vyos-1x.git/commit/?id=4ef110fd2c501b718344c72d495ad7e16d2bd465'/>
<id>urn:sha1:4ef110fd2c501b718344c72d495ad7e16d2bd465</id>
<content type='text'>
We will use _ as CLI level divider. The XML definition filename and also
the Python helper should match the CLI node.

Example:
set interfaces ethernet -&gt; interfaces_ethernet.xml.in
set interfaces bond -&gt; interfaces_bond.xml.in
set service dhcp-server -&gt; service_dhcp-server-xml.in
</content>
</entry>
</feed>
